COVID-19 and the subsequent lockdowns shifted the way users access and borrow books from public libraries. Loans of eBooks and audiobooks increased during lockdowns, and this trend could be here to stay. However, while the authors of books held in public and educational libraries receive payments under the lending rights scheme, the scheme does not cover digital materials like eBooks and audiobooks. In this panel we are joined by Olivia Lanchester (CEO, Australian Society of Authors) and Trish Hepworth (Director of Policy and Education, ALIA) to talk about the much needed reforms to Australia’s lending rights scheme.
